Amorphous Three-Phase Five-Limb Transformer Cores  Iron-based amorphous distribution transformer cores are mainly used in a variety of power distribution transformers with usual frequency from 50Hz to 10 KHz; Working in high power switch inductor, amorphous core is able to work under frequency even 50 KHz. Among other metal alloy, amorphous has the highest saturate induction density and high permeability, low coercivity, low loss and low exciting current but with good temperature and aging stability.   Amorphous Material Characteristics:  Amorphous alloy is a newly energy-saving material, fast cooling solidification manufacturing techniques. Its physical status is metal atom and it ranks disorder amorphous substance. The combination of amorphous alloy is different from silicon material. Amorphous alloy is easier to be magnetized. This material is widely used in transformers. Because the magnetization process is easy, the no-load loss is substantially low. Processing: 1. Cutting: Amorphous alloys materials are very hard and it is quite difficult to cut with conventional tools, so it should be taken in account to reduce the shear volume in the design. 2. Stacking:The monolithic of the amorphous alloy is extremely thin and the surface of the material is not very flat, then the core fill factor is quite low. 3. Fixing and molding: Amorphous alloys are very sensitive to the mechanical stress, so it is necessary to take special tightening measures in the production process. 4. Magnetic field heat treatment: In order to obtain excellent low loss characteristics, heat treatment must be done to the amorphous magnetic alloy core, which is the core technology of the whole process.
